LOS ANGELES (August 08, 2024) – Los Angeles Department of Water and Power (LADWP) announced today that customers have continued to heed the call to conserve water during this historic drought. LADWP customers achieved an 11% reduction in July, that’s a record for any July on record for Los Angeles.

Since 2009, LADWP has continued with Phase 2 of the City of Los Angeles’ Emergency Water Conservation Plan, adopted in 1977 and last amended in 2016, limiting watering to three days per week.
